引言在数字化时代,数据分析已成为企业和个人提升竞争力的关键。Python作为一种功能强大且易于学习的编程语言,在数据分析领域展现出巨大潜力。本文将带领读者轻松入门Python数据分析,掌握高效统计方法...
在数字化时代,数据分析已成为企业和个人提升竞争力的关键。Python作为一种功能强大且易于学习的编程语言,在数据分析领域展现出巨大潜力。本文将带领读者轻松入门Python数据分析,掌握高效统计方法,并开启数据洞察之旅。
Python拥有丰富的数据分析库和工具,如NumPy、Pandas、Matplotlib等,为数据处理、分析和可视化提供便捷。
Python语法简洁,易于上手,适合初学者学习。
Python在多个领域都有应用,如科学计算、人工智能、网络爬虫等,有助于拓宽知识面。
收集数据是数据分析的第一步,可以从网络、数据库、文件等多种途径获取数据。
数据处理包括数据清洗、转换、合并等操作,以确保数据质量。
数据分析包括描述性统计、推断性统计、假设检验等方法,用于揭示数据中的规律和趋势。
数据可视化将数据以图形或图表的形式呈现,帮助人们更直观地理解数据。
从数据中提取洞察,为决策提供支持。
以下是一个简单的Python数据分析实例,展示如何使用Pandas和Matplotlib进行数据分析和可视化。
import pandas as pd
# 加载数据
data = pd.read_csv("sales_data.csv")
# 查看数据基本信息
print(data.info())# 清洗数据
data = data.dropna() # 删除缺失值
data = data[data['sales'] > 0] # 过滤销售数据
# 转换数据类型
data['sales'] = data['sales'].astype(float)# 计算平均销售额
average_sales = data['sales'].mean()
print(f"平均销售额: {average_sales}")
# 计算销售额排名前10的产品
top_sales = data.nlargest(10, 'sales')
print(top_sales)import matplotlib.pyplot as plt
# 绘制折线图
plt.figure(figsize=(10, 6))
plt.plot(data['date'], data['sales'], marker='o')
plt.title("销售额随时间变化趋势")
plt.xlabel("日期")
plt.ylabel("销售额")
plt.grid(True)
plt.show()Python数据分析为数据科学家、数据分析师和爱好者提供了强大的工具和资源。通过学习Python数据分析,我们可以轻松掌握数据分析和可视化技巧,开启数据洞察之旅。